Abstract | The development of the skyscraper is an American story that combines architectural history, economic power, and technological achievement. Each city in the United States can be identified by the profile of its buildings. The design of the tops of skyscrapers was the inspiration for the students in the author's high-school ceramic class to develop their own handbuilt creations for the tops of buildings. The combination of the engineering advancements and the development of business identities that came together to create these architectural forms are a fascinating history of science, architecture, and commerce. This article presents a high school lesson that allows students to create a series of sketches for their own original design for a top of a skyscraper. (Contains 1 online resource.) (ERIC). |
